语法错误-html td标记中的PHP if语句

时间:2019-07-04 17:12:11

标签: php html

我在浏览器中收到此消息:解析错误:语法错误,意外的'if'(T_IF)

我一直在制作一个HTML表,显示Woocommerce产品的价格。

我见过很多类似的问题,但是与我自己的问题无关。

问题应该在此代码中...

            <tr>
                <td>'. $product_variation->get_name() .'</td>
                <td>'. $product_variation->get_regular_price() .'</td>
                <td>'
                 if($sale_price) {
                   echo $sale_price;
                    }else {
                   echo $product_variation->get_regular_price();
                    }
                '</td>
            </tr>';´´´

1 个答案:

答案 0 :(得分:0)

在此附近使用php标签:-

<?php
if($sale_price) {
  echo $sale_price;
}else {
echo $product_variation->get_regular_price();
}
?>